Anyone casting aspersions at Obasanjo for visiting the family of a man killed extra-judiciously is being less than charitable, Obasanjo is not my favorite person but the pursue of peace in any legitimate way should be applauded. In the pursuit of peace, no option should be ruled out. In case most people do not know, even the Americans fighting the Taliban are also negotiating with them at the same time.

In every large scale dispute there are always the major extremist elements who stir up things but more importantly there is the larger moderate element who provide a support network for them either through coercion or sympathy with their supposed cause.
The best way to undermine terrorism is to undermine that support network by showing the moderate elements that peace is achievable and should always be a preferred option.

Lets leave Obasanjo's visit out of this and not even blame the government (if indeed they sent him to the family as a peace overture). Let us put this firmly at the feet of those who seem to want to maim and kill at any cost and hope that this action will further undermine them in the eyes of the moderate elements and ultimately lead to them being put in check as soon as possible, afterall this is their own kith and kin they've just murdered.
